% podman-volume-inspect 1

NAME

podman-volume-inspect - Get detailed information on one or more volumes

SYNOPSIS

podman volume inspect [options] volume [...]

DESCRIPTION

Display detailed information on one or more volumes. The output can be formatted using the --format flag and a Go template. To get detailed information about all the existing volumes, use the --all flag. Volumes can be queried individually by providing their full name or a unique partial name.

OPTIONS

--all, -a

Inspect all volumes.

--format, -f=format

Format volume output using Go template

Valid placeholders for the Go template are listed below:

Placeholder Description
.Anonymous Indicates whether volume is anonymous
.CreatedAt ... Volume creation time
.Driver Volume driver
.GID GID the volume was created with
.Labels ... Label information associated with the volume
.LockNumber Number of the volume's Libpod lock
.MountCount Number of times the volume is mounted
.Mountpoint Source of volume mount point
.Name Volume name
.NeedsChown Indicates volume needs to be chowned on first use
.NeedsCopyUp Indicates volume needs dest data copied up on first use
.Options ... Volume options
.Scope Volume scope
.Status ... Status of the volume
.StorageID StorageID of the volume
.Timeout Timeout of the volume
.UID UID the volume was created with

--help

Print usage statement

EXAMPLES

Inspect named volume.

$ podman volume inspect myvol
[
     {
          "Name": "myvol",
          "Driver": "local",
          "Mountpoint": "/home/myusername/.local/share/containers/storage/volumes/myvol/_data",
          "CreatedAt": "2023-03-13T16:26:48.423069028-04:00",
          "Labels": {},
          "Scope": "local",
          "Options": {},
          "MountCount": 0,
          "NeedsCopyUp": true,
          "NeedsChown": true
     }
]

Inspect all volumes.

$ podman volume inspect --all
[
     {
          "Name": "myvol",
          "Driver": "local",
          "Mountpoint": "/home/myusername/.local/share/containers/storage/volumes/myvol/_data",
          "CreatedAt": "2023-03-13T16:26:48.423069028-04:00",
          "Labels": {},
          "Scope": "local",
          "Options": {},
          "MountCount": 0,
          "NeedsCopyUp": true,
          "NeedsChown": true
     }
]

Inspect named volume and display its Driver and Scope field.

$ podman volume inspect --format "{{.Driver}} {{.Scope}}" myvol
local local
